Opinion

Opinion by

Wilson, J.

In accordance with stipulation of counsel that the merchandise consists of halibut-liver oil the same in all material respects as that the subject of D. C. Andrews & Co., Inc. v. United States (72 Treas. Dec. 383, T. D. 49190), the claim of the plaintiff was sustained.
